Bridge Loans: Your Quick Guide to Real Estate Investment

Need immediate backing to purchase a new property while disposing of your existing one? Look into bridge loans! These unique mortgages offer a useful solution, delivering resources quickly to bridge the gap between sales. A bridge loan is usually a brief loan with elevated costs , designed to resolve urgent real estate situations. They’re commonly used by property owners who are prepared to move but haven't finalized on the liquidation of their current property. Understanding the details and potential drawbacks is important before agreeing to one.

Understanding Bridge Loan Rates: What to Expect

Bridge temporary costs can feel mystifying, especially when you are navigating a immediate real estate move. Usually, these temporary credit options carry elevated borrowing expenses than standard mortgages. You should anticipate rates falling from seven percent to 12%, sometimes with points added in addition to the base cost. Several factors, like your financial rating, the LTV ratio, and the overall financial situation, will influence the ending rate you secure. Hence, it's essential to get multiple quotes from several financial institutions to locate the favorable offer.

Gap Financing vs. Traditional Mortgages : A Interest Rate Analysis

When evaluating funding a home purchase, several individuals grapple with the challenge of whether to select a gap loan or a traditional mortgage . A key factor in this choice is the rate of interest . Generally, bridge loans come with significantly higher interest rates compared to standard home loans. This is because they are a riskier financial product , meant for a brief timeframe . Traditional mortgages , being guaranteed by a extended agreement, usually present more competitive interest rates . Here's a simple breakdown:

  • Short-Term Loans : Often fall between 7% and 11% .
  • Standard Home Loans: Typically fall between 3% and 7%.

Therefore, while gap financing may be a helpful option in certain situations , the greater interest costs must be thoroughly assessed before making a ultimate determination.
